Big Changes to the RTM Plugin System: What You Need to Know (For Pro Users)

Dear RTM Pro users,

We’re making a major change to the architecture of the RTM plugin system — and before this news goes public, we wanted you, as someone who has trusted us from the start, to hear it first, clearly and directly from us.

What’s Not Changing: What You Already Paid For Stays Yours

We’re splitting the RTM system into several modular addons for Elementor. The four core addons you’ve already been using:

  • RTM Elements — advanced widgets, extensions, and icons
  • RTM Woo — WooCommerce integration
  • RTM Blog — blogging and content features
  • RTM Templates — a collection of ready-to-use templates

If you’re an existing Pro user, these four addons are free for you, forever — no additional conditions, no upgrade fees, no time limit. You won’t lose a single feature you already paid for.

What’s Changing: How We Manage Licenses

Going forward, every addon will be managed through one central account: RTM Hub. There you can:

  • See all the addons you own
  • Manage licenses and activations
  • Track updates for each addon

You’ll be asked to connect your existing license to your RTM Hub account. This process doesn’t remove or limit your access — it simply moves how it’s managed to a more structured system.

Roadmap Ahead: New Addons We’re Planning

Beyond the four addons above, we’re also preparing new addons for other categories in the Elementor ecosystem — including additional core infrastructure, motion/animation, a booking system, and an advanced form builder. Exact numbers and details are still being finalized, and we’ll announce them gradually as each one matures.

These new addons are not part of the Pro package you already purchased, simply because they were never planned back then. However, as a token of appreciation, existing Pro users will get preferential pricing if you choose to upgrade to these addons later. Pricing details will be announced alongside each addon’s release.

We’re also preparing a Full Seat plan — access to the entire RTMKit addon ecosystem, including future addons, in a single license. Available as Yearly or Lifetime (limited quota).

Questions You Might Have

Is my old license still valid?
Yes. You just need to connect it to your RTM Hub account.

Am I required to upgrade to the new addons?
No. It’s entirely optional.

Why is a centralized account needed now?
To simplify license management, updates, and support going forward as the number of addons grows.
